About SOLGOLD PLC

https://www.solgold.com.au/

SolGold PLC is a mineral exploration and development company focused on the discovery, definition, and development of world-class copper and gold deposits. The company's principal activities are centered on its extensive concession holdings within Ecuador's Andean copper belt. SolGold aims to unlock the region's mineral wealth through innovative exploration techniques and a commitment to sustainable production. Its mission is to contribute to a net-zero future by developing the copper resources essential for global electrification and the energy transition.
